Hill Adds Green, Hamm, Reynolds and Rooney to Congressional Campaign Team

Businessman David Hill has enlisted some heavy hitters to co-chair his campaign for the 5th Congressional District. Hobby Lobby President Steve Green, Continental Resources Founder and Executive Chairman Harold Hamm, Community Activist Dr. Suzanne Reynolds and First National Bank of Oklahoma CEO Pat Rooney have signed onto the campaign.

Those names could help provide a boost to a campaign where Hill is trying to gain name recognition in a Republican field heavy with popular candidates.

Here’s what Hill’s new co-chairs said about him in announcing they are joining the campaign.

“David Hill is the leader we need at this time in our history,” stated Green, who also is the Board Chairman for Museum of the Bible. “David’s motive for running is to serve the state and nation he loves, not to build a political resume. His success in the business world, his deep and genuine faith, and the extraordinary family he has raised should give voters the confidence that David is the voice the Fifth District needs to fix Congress.”

“David Hill is exactly what Washington needs,” said Hamm. “The Trump Administration’s positive impact on the economy illustrates the transformative impact a business leader can make in Washington. David Hill will bring his business acumen and needed outsider perspective as he represents the hard-working people of Oklahoma.”

“I have known David, his wife Shannon, and their children for over 10 years. Shannon and David are a true team that has raised six outstanding children. When they saw a need, they founded a Christian school.  When David saw an opportunity to launch a marathon to support the Oklahoma City National Memorial and Museum, he didn’t just talk, he went to work.  That hard work and is what we can expect from David in Washington,” said Reynolds.

“David Hill’s distinguished career as a job-creator in the manufacturing sector proves he is a problem solver. And as we know, there are many problems in Washington to be solved, specifically, Nancy Pelosi and her ilk,” said Rooney.
